LOG: [C] Disallow declarations where a statement is required (#92908)
This fixes a regression introduced in
8bd06d5b65845e5e01dd899a2deb773580460b89 where Clang began to accept a
declaration where a statement is required. e.g.,
```
if (1)
int x; // Previously accepted, now properly rejected
```
Fixes #92775

diff --git a/clang/lib/Parse/ParseStmt.cpp b/clang/lib/Parse/ParseStmt.cpp
index b0af04451166ca..c25203243ee49b 100644
--- a/clang/lib/Parse/ParseStmt.cpp
+++ b/clang/lib/Parse/ParseStmt.cpp
@@ -239,7 +239,15 @@ StmtResult Parser::ParseStatementOrDeclarationAfterAttributes(
auto IsStmtAttr = [](ParsedAttr &Attr) { return Attr.isStmtAttr(); };
bool AllAttrsAreStmtAttrs = llvm::all_of(CXX11Attrs, IsStmtAttr) &&
llvm::all_of(GNUAttrs, IsStmtAttr);
- if (((GNUAttributeLoc.isValid() && !(HaveAttrs && AllAttrsAreStmtAttrs)) ||
+ // In C, the grammar production for statement (C23 6.8.1p1) does not allow
+ // for declarations, which is
diff erent from C++ (C++23 [stmt.pre]p1). So
+ // in C++, we always allow a declaration, but in C we need to check whether
+ // we're in a statement context that allows declarations. e.g., in C, the
+ // following is invalid: if (1) int x;
+ if ((getLangOpts().CPlusPlus || getLangOpts().MicrosoftExt ||
+ (StmtCtx & ParsedStmtContext::AllowDeclarationsInC) !=
+ ParsedStmtContext()) &&
+ ((GNUAttributeLoc.isValid() && !(HaveAttrs && AllAttrsAreStmtAttrs)) ||
isDeclarationStatement())) {
SourceLocation DeclStart = Tok.getLocation(), DeclEnd;
DeclGroupPtrTy Decl;
